I have broken two driveshafts roadracing with a stock motor. I use a racing clutch and rear end (stock gear ratio) and Hoosier slicks so that will put more of a load on the entire drivetrain.
Inspect the welds and look for cracks as that appeared to be the problem with mine. I noticed some discoloration which indicated that the crack had been there for a while.
Since we have started an inspection/replacement program, we haven't had any more problems. Reliability is very important so once you can identify issues/weak links and address them, life gets better.
